The Tower of London• It was a fortress, a

palace, a prison and the King’s Zoo

• Now it is a museum• It was built by

William the Conqueror in the 11th century.

St. Paul’s Cathedral

• Was built by Sir Christopher Wren• Was built in the 17th century after the Great

Fire• There’s one of the largest bells in it

Trafalgar Square

• Is in the centre of London.

• In the middle of the square stands a tall column,a monument to Admiral Nelson.

• The National Gallery is in Trafalgar Square

Westminster

• The political centre of London.• Westminster Palace is a long grey building

with towers which is the Houses of Parliament.

• The large clock in 1 of the towers is Big Ben.

Buckingham Palace• The Queen of

England lives in Buckingham Palace.

• There is a monument in front of it which is the Queen Victoria Memorial
